Abstract

The utility model discloses a removal strutting arrangement of laser cladding robot for naval vessel should remove strutting arrangement and include: the supporting seat, be equipped with gyro wheel mechanism in the bottom of supporting seat, periphery at the supporting seat is equipped with a plurality of supporting regulating mechanism, and supporting regulating mechanism includes the exhibition arm, and the one end of exhibition arm is passed through the hinge and is articulated with the supporting seat, is connected with the level(l)ing foot at the other end of opening up the arm. Will the utility model discloses a removing strutting arrangement and being applied to the naval vessel for behind the laser cladding robot, robotic device occupation space is little, removes in a flexible way, convenient, and the trafficability characteristic is good, and equipment support stability is good, has realized the green remanufacturing to naval vessel spare part, has satisfied ensureing and the emergency maintenance needs along with warship guarantee, offshore of naval vessel, has improved the naval vessel guarantee capability of navy.

Background technology
In recent years, energy problem increasingly becomed the emphasis and focus of World Focusing, to make full use of resource, reduce right Environmental pollution obtains wideling popularize application for the Green Remanufacturing Technique of target.As the shipping industry of hat of integrated industrial, mirror The complexity of association and composition in it to numerous industries, the development process of its green manufacturing is substantially slow in other industry, army It is even more so with naval vessel, Green Remanufacturing Technique carry out during Material in Ship Design and Manufacture, operational support it is very urgent, particularly More should comprehensively pay close attention in naval vessel maintenance during one's term of military service, put forth effort to implement.
Laser melting and coating technique is a kind of new surface-coating technology, and the technology is to be preset in alloy material, powder again Manufacture component surface, either will treat that cladding material is transported to and remanufacture using automatic feeding (powder feeder or wire-feed motor) Component surface, Jing high energy laser beams fusing is allowed to be fused with matrix surface, forms low dilution and matrix in metallurgy With reference to cladding layer.This kind of method can be obtained in component surface has excellent corrosion-resistant, wear-resistant and shock resistance, knot The flawless high-performance coating of strong with joint efforts and suitable subsequent mechanical processing characteristics.Parts service life significantly extends, and not There is problem of environmental pollution, and can improve or improve the characteristic of substrate material surface, with it is wear-resisting, anti-corrosion, heat-resisting, distort it is little, Hot melt area is little, coating scope is big, automation efficiency high the features such as, be-kind of integrated light, mechanical, electrical, computer, material, physics, change The new and high technology of etc. multi-door subject.Precision Machining is that the component surface Jing after laser melting coating is carried out into precision optical machinery processing, It is set to recover the requirement of its life size precision.
Due to the overseas military base quantity of China seldom, and naval vessel damage part and parts damages mode exist it is uncertain Feature, therefore will have emergent during higher requirement, particularly ship navigation with warship guarantee and offshore guarantee to naval vessel Maintenance;Separately, in view of limited space on naval vessel and reducing demand in terms of marine environmental pollution, therefore, how research will swash Light cladding Green Remanufacturing Technique be applied to naval vessel with warship guarantee, offshore guarantee and emergency maintenance, develop and equip and be small-sized, light Just, the flexible laser melting coating of movement processes high-performance comprehensive equipment, becomes those skilled in the art's important topic urgently to be resolved hurrily.

Specific embodiment
Below in conjunction with the accompanying drawings detailed non-limitative illustration is done to specific embodiment of the present utility model.
As shown in figure 1, Mobile support device of the naval vessel of the present utility model with laser melting coating robot, including:Support base 1;Idler wheel mechanism is provided with the bottom of support base 1, idler wheel mechanism includes multiple universal wheels 2;It is provided with multiple in the periphery of support base 1 Support adjustment mechanism, each support adjustment mechanism includes exhibition arm 4, and the one end for opening up arm 4 is articulated and connected by hinge 3 with support base 1, The other end of exhibition arm 4 is connected with level adjuster 5.
As shown in Figures 2 and 3, wherein, be provided with positioning table 11 on the top of support base 1;Further, positioning table 11 is upper End is provided with gradient;The setting of positioning table 11, is easy to the fuselage bottom to robot to position, and realizes accurate, quick with robot Install.Wherein, it is provided with outwardly directed some to otic placode 12 in the periphery of support base 1, each pair otic placode 12 is setting up and down, per adjacent Two pairs of otic placodes 12 between be provided with for opening up the abutment face 13 that arm 4 reclines, the otic placode passed through for hinge 3 is provided with otic placode and is led to Hole 121.The setting of otic placode 12, facilitates implementation being articulated and connected for exhibition arm 4 and support base 1;Because support base 1 is provided with abutment face 13, during robot moving equipment, can rotate exhibition arm 4 makes it be close to abutment face 13, takes up room so as to reduce, and improves machine Device people's equipment on naval vessel by property.
As shown in figures 1 and 3, hinge 3 passes through the otic placode through hole 121 of support base 1, the correspondence of universal wheel 2 in idler wheel mechanism Installed in the lower end of each hinge 3.Universal wheel 2 is arranged at the lower end of hinge 3, it is possible to provide larger rolling support area, improves Stability when robot device passes through on naval vessel.
As shown in figure 4, wherein, it is a rigid bar that a kind of structure for opening up arm 4 is.The exhibition arm of this kind of structure, structure letter It is single, it is easy to manufacture, but open up the length of arm and can not adjust.
As shown in figure 5, wherein, opening up another kind of structure of arm 4 is, using modular construction, the modular construction includes adapter sleeve 42 and connecting rod 41, connecting rod 41 includes bar portion 411 and the head 412 being wholely set, and bar portion 411 inserts the inner chamber of adapter sleeve 42 In, adapter sleeve 42 and bar portion 411 are connected by holding screw 43.The exhibition arm of this kind of structure, can adjust the insertion connection of bar portion 411 Length in the inner chamber of set 42, so that the entirely adjustable length of exhibition arm 4, can meet the needs at different work scene, adaptability is good.
As shown in fig. 6, wherein, a kind of structure of level adjuster 5 is:Including screw rod 51 and being arranged at the lower end of screw rod 51 Runners 52.The level adjuster of this kind of structure, simple structure, it is easy to manufacture, but the whole height of level adjuster can not adjust.
As shown in fig. 7, wherein, another kind of structure of level adjuster 5 is:Including silk braid 53, the lower end of silk braid 53 is arranged The inner chamber for having runners 52, silk braid 53 is threadedly coupled with screw rod 51, and the upper end of screw rod 51 is connected with handle 56 by bearing pin 57.In silk The outside of set 53 is arranged with sleeve 54, and sleeve 54 is slidably connected with silk braid 53 by anti-turn screw 55;As shown in figure 8, in silk braid 53 lateral wall is provided with along its axially extending stopper slot 531, and anti-turn screw 55 is located in stopper slot 531.In sleeve 54 Upper end is fixed with spacing end cap 542, and the lower section positioned at spacing end cap 542 in sleeve 54 is provided with limit baffle ring 541;In screw rod 51 Upper end be provided with spacing stopper 511, spacing stopper 511 is located between spacing end cap 542 and limit baffle ring 541.This kind of structure Level adjuster, screw rod 51 is rotated by sleeve 54 using welding or other fixed forms with exhibition arm 4 by handle 56, can be driven Silk braid 53 and runners 52 rise or fall, and realize the Level tune to robot device, and the whole height of level adjuster is adjustable, The needs at different work scene can be met, adaptability is good.
As shown in figure 9, by naval vessel laser melting coating robot II be placed on Mobile support device I of the present utility model On support seat 1, robot easily and flexibly can be moved on naval vessel by the operation for needing to process or keep in repair by universal wheel 2 Scene;It is articulated and connected with support base 1 due to opening up arm 4, during robot moving equipment, inwardly rotates exhibition arm 4 and be close to it and prop up Support seat 1 abutment face 13, can reduce and take up room, improve robot device on naval vessel by property;Reach operation field, It is turned out opening up arm 4, adjusts level adjuster 5, make universal wheel 2 depart from ground, continues to adjust level adjuster 5, until machine People's equipment is in horizontality, you can starting device, carries out laser melting coating green processing to naval vessel damage part and remanufactures, and meets Needing with warship guarantee, offshore guarantee and emergency maintenance for naval vessel, improves naval vessels supportability.
